Transaction f695e17fc25994d511371f6fc23d9bcc2b64c80aa4539f1a86bc475c37a6f839

109 Input
2 Outputs
  • f695e17fc25994d511371f6fc23d9bcc2b64c80aa4539f1a86bc475c37a6f839:0
  • value  754151
    address  36ZfmjBjgqM7wdnGmWZZX4sN8aWRgWQWx3
  • f695e17fc25994d511371f6fc23d9bcc2b64c80aa4539f1a86bc475c37a6f839:1
  • value  147416061
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s